Characterisation of human surfactant protein A and recombinant human vimentin in their modulation of HPV16 pseudovirus infection

Infection by oncogenic human papillomavirus (HPV) is the primary cause of cervical cancer, where low-and middle-income countries (LMIC) have the highest incidence.
